If you've had a lot of wacky weather that would certainly cause odd growth. Not the red, that looks pretty normal, as Jeri said, but the small/crinkled leaves. Extreme heat or too much rain will cause abnormal growth for that cycle. Once the weather settles down any new growth from then on should be fine.
